Emotion

Despite all attempts

To thwart emotion

Like a boomerang, it'll return

 

Lurking in the shadows,

Upon the corridors

Waiting for opportunities

To creep back

 

Though this beast

Can lay dormant

One day it will awaken,

So be warned

 

Prolonging this natural yearning,

Can only sink you deeper

Into the forming pit

 

Now that you are aware

Have a nice day

Take care
